Subway - Closed

 
2421 W 6th St Stillwater, OK 74075
(405) 372-7770

Business Map

Map Details

Area: Stillwater, OK 74075

Coordinates: 36.1154864537169, -97.0897245736211

KML: KML

Back to Subway - Closed Profile

Night Mode